How much do senior full stack develop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for senior full stack developer in Boise, ID is $56.40,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$46.92 and $64.95 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Senior Full Stack Developer vs Backend Developer?

AspectSenior Full Stack DeveloperBackend Developer
Required SkillsProficiency in both frontend and backend technologies, such as JavaScript, HTML, CSS, and server-side languages like Node.js, Python, or JavaSpecialized in server-side development, working with languages like Java, Python, Ruby, or PHP, and database management
Work EnvironmentCollaborates across frontend and backend teams, often involved in full project lifecycleFocuses primarily on backend systems, APIs, and database integration
Common UsageUsed in roles requiring full project oversight and versatile development skillsUsed in roles focused on server-side logic, database management, and API development

The main difference is that a Senior Full Stack Developer handles both frontend and backend development, providing a comprehensive approach to projects, while a Backend Developer specializes solely in server-side logic and database management. Both roles require strong programming skills, but the Full Stack Developer's expertise spans the entire technology stack.

How does a senior full stack developer typically collaborate with cross-functional teams during a project lifecycle?

As a Senior Full Stack Developer, you'll frequently collaborate with designers, product managers, QA engineers, and other developers to deliver end-to-end solutions. You'll be involved in requirements discussions, offer technical guidance, and help align frontend and backend development with business goals. Your role often includes code reviews, mentoring junior team members, and ensuring seamless integration across various systems. This collaborative environment encourages knowledge sharing and innovation while ensuring project success.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ior full stack develop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Full Stack Developer, you need advanced proficiency in both front-end and back-end programming languages, frameworks, and a solid understanding of software architecture, usually supported by a relevant degree and several years of experience. Mastery of tools such as Git, Docker, CI/CD systems, and cloud platforms like AWS or Azure is typically required, alongside familiarity with databases and version control systems. Strong problem-solving abilities, leadership, effective communication, and collaboration skills set exceptional developers apart. These skills and qualities are crucial for delivering robust, scalable solutions while mentoring teams and efficiently bridging gaps between client requirements and technical implementation.

What is a senior full stack developer?

Senior Full Stack Developers are experienced professionals who design, develop, and maintain both the front-end and back-end components of web applications. They are proficient in multiple programming languages and frameworks, enabling them to handle servers, databases, APIs, and user interfaces. In addition to coding, they often lead development teams, make architectural decisions, and ensure software quality and scalability. Their expertise allows them to oversee the entire application lifecycle, from concept to deployment.
